MealViewer Available for the 2022–23 School Year
The District’s Office of Nutrition Support Services is excited to offer MealViewer for staff and families starting this school year. MealViewer is an online menu service that keeps school communities up-to-date on their school’s daily breakfast and lunch menus. It also allows families to create a profile for their students that includes their allergens, notifying them when that allergen is on the menu. It even gives students an opportunity to provide feedback on school meals.
MealViewer is currently available for a majority of CPS schools, with the remaining schools being added over the course of the upcoming school year.
